How to realize X arm GR/IR alignment(from IMMT2(SR3) to ETMXY)

  1. Enter Alignment Mode1

  2. Enter Alignment Mode2

  3. X arm GR alignment (ITMY misalign).

  4. X arm GR alignment (Resonate GR).

  5. X arm GR alignment (Check spot position).

  6. X arm GR alignment (PR3 Dithering).

  7. X arm GR alignment (find good FP axis & PR3 P/Y).

  8. X arm FP axis is established and PR3 P/Y is fixed.

  9. X arm GR alignment (Record good TMSX).

  10. X arm IR alignment (Resonate IR).

  11. X arm IR alignment (PR2-IMMT2 alignment).

  12. X arm IR alignment (GR/IR resonance check).

  13. X arm GR/IR alignment Established.

  14. Y arm IR alignment Preparation.

  15. Y arm IR alignment (Resonate IR).

  16. Y arm IR alignment (Check spot position on ETMY).

  17. Y arm IR align (Adjust BS for ETMY spot centering).

  18. Y arm IR alignment (ITMY,ETMY alignment).

  19. Y arm IR alignment (Check spot on ITMY).

  20. Y arm IR alignment Established.

  21. Y arm IR alignment (Record good TMSY).

  22. Y arm IR alignment Established.

  23. Y arm GR alignment (Resonate GR).

  24. Y arm GR alignment (TMSY GR maximize with SR3).

  25. Y arm GR/IR alignment Established.

  26. FPMI Recovery (Exit from alignment mode).

  27. FPMI Recovery (Align ITMX).

  28. FPMI Recovery (Start FPMI).
